M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
that
considers
issues
relevant to open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
Brand new
advancements in
electronic educational technology are empowering
people
in nations all aver the world
to participate in online courses.
These massive open online courses are
normally free
but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
There are a variety of
issues that
learning technology organizations
have to struggle with
now that distance learning technology is
advancing so quickly.
How can stakeholders
make sure that
the quality of education provided by these
MOOC classes is
tolerable?
How can institutions
certify that
lecturers are properly credentialed
to teach online MOOC courses?
What different business models are being used by
institutions like
Google+ to conduct these massive open online courses?
What teaching practices and experimental evaluation strategies are optimal?
How can we
deal with
inadequate
student motivation and high
student dropout rates?
